About

Frommer's books aren't written by committee, by A.I., or by travel writers who simply pop in briefly to a destination and then consider the job done. We use seasoned, locally-based journalists like Elizabeth Heath, Donald Strachan, and Michelle Schoenung, plus long-time Italy experts Stephen Brewer and Stephen Keeling to research our guides. They've checked out all of Italy's best hotels, attractions, shops, wineries, and restaurants in person, and offer authoritative, candid reviews that will help you find the venues that suit your tastes and budget, whether you're a backpacker or on a romantic honeymoon.



Most importantly, none of these journalists are shy about telling you what you should see…and what you can skip without regret. As well, no entity has paid to be in this guide-or any Frommer's guide. At Frommer's, we pride ourselves on decades of journalistic integrity.
With helpful advice and honest recommendations from Frommer's expert authors, you'll walk among the ancient ruins of Pompeii, float along the canals of Venice, appreciate Renaissance masterworks in Florence, explore off-the-beaten-path Puglia and live la dolce vita in Rome―as well as discover timeless wonders such as the vineyards of Tuscany and cliff-top towns perched along the Amalfi Coast and the Cinque Terre.
Inside the guide:



Full-color photos and helpful maps throughout, including a detachable foldout map

• 6 Detailed itineraries for planning your trip to suit your schedule and interests (and help you avoid lines and crowds)
• Compelling cultural information so that you'll better understand the history, cuisine, and traditions of Italy
• Candid reviews of the best restaurants, historic sights, museums, tours, shops, and experiences―and no-punches-pulled info on the ones not worth your time and money. We also include star ratings, so you can scan the text quickly and see which options are most appealing.
• Accurate, up-to-date info on transportation, useful websites, telephone numbers, health care options and more
• Budget-planning help with exact pricing listed, so there's never any guessing, along with ways to save money, whether you're traveling on a shoestring or in the lap of luxury
• Helpful planning advice for getting to Italy, getting around, getting the best price on lodgings and attractions

About Frommer's: There's a reason Frommer's has been the most trusted name in travel for more than 65 years. Arthur Frommer created the best-selling guide series in 1957 to help American servicemen fulfill their dreams of travel in Europe, and since then, we have published thousands of titles, become a household name, and helped millions upon millions of people realize their own dreams of seeing our planet.
